Kimley-Horn is Hiring a Project Accountant Near Tallahassee, FL

Overview

Our growing Regional Accounting team is seeking an entry-level Project Accountant based in our Tallahassee, FL Office. The ideal candidate would be a self-starter with problem-solving skills and the ability to develop and maintain strong relationships. This individual would support full project lifecycle business functions by partnering with Project Managers and their engineering teams to serve external clients.

Responsibilities

Financial Analysis/Profitability Review

  • Partner with Project Managers regarding business-related functions, including contract review, project setup, sub-consultant management, monthly profitability review, and invoicing and collections efforts
  • Consult routinely with project leadership teams to review and analyze project financial performance to ensure proper revenue recognition
  • Work in a fast-paced, collaborative team setting to manage monthly deadlines and Regional performance goals

Invoicing/Accounts Receivable Management

  • Ensure projects are billed accurately and timely according to client-specific contract terms
  • Timely coordination with clients regarding invoicing and accounts receivable/collection efforts
  • Identify complex accounts receivable issues and partner with Business leadership to resolve or escalate appropriately
  • Coordinate with outside firms to manage sub-consultant invoicing and payment workflow

Compliance Reporting and Contract Management

  • Review contracts to ensure proper project setup in accordance with terms and conditions
  • Utilize business tools and reporting to track project compliance and end-of-year reporting
  • Understand contractual obligations that impact different business operations, including revenue recognition, audits, sub-consultant management, and client compliance requirements

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ree required. Accounting, Finance, or related degree a plus
  • Solid understanding of accounting fundamentals
  • High degree of professionalism and strong people skills
  • Must be an excellent team player
  • Strong knowledge of Microsoft Office suite
  • Travel (driving) to other offices within the region as needed
